Py-SIM800L-USSD

Unstructured Supplementary Service Data (USSD) network result parser with Python language

SIM800L is a complete Quad-band GSM/GPRS solution in a SMT type which can be embedded in the customer applications.

SIM800L support Quad-band 850/900/1800/1900MHz, it can transmit Voice, SMS and data information with low power consumption. With tiny size of 15.817.82.4 mm, it can fit into slim and compact demands of customer design. Featuring Bluetooth and Embedded AT, it allows total cost savings and fast time-to-market for customer applications.
